The President's Message

Message from the President

- Dr. Ileana Rodríguez

  Dr. Ileana Rodriguez-Garcia

Dr. Carlos Albizu’s motto “Más allá del saber, llega el amor” (Love Reaches beyond Knowledge) has been CAU’s central theme and most treasured value.  For over forty years, this message of love has been repeated in official events as well as in various forums.

 

However, it is my responsibility, as the Third President of this University, to invite you to reflect on the true meaning of these words and their impact as a transforming force, as we put them into practice.

 

Everything we have learned can be found in the books written by great thinkers and professionals who devoted their lives to sharing their knowledge.  This knowledge can be acquired and transmitted to others.  However, true knowledge is the one you have been able to take deep into your heart and make it your code of life.  The greatest impact we can make on others is through putting into practice what we express in words.  We can have a lot of knowledge on a given subject and be able to talk about it, but this intellectual knowledge can only become alive when we apply it.  Otherwise, these abstract words will not soar.

 

This is why our performance, wherever we find ourselves, must be guided by the tools which we have developed inside ourselves to do good to others.  Only then will love flourish, like the seeds our hearts have planted along the road.  Love is not acquired with knowledge, but through the good actions we have carried out unselfishly and by putting aside our personal interests.  This love we offer transcends into a more powerful feeling.

 

I did not have the honor of personally knowing Dr. Carlos Albizu, but I have learned about him through many of you.  I have learned about his joy for life, his vision and the love he infused into his dreams.  The essence of his words has reached our hearts with the same intensity with which they were originally expressed by Dr. Albizu.  In this way, we perpetuate his motto and his legacy, which give us a better sense of direction, not only to us, but to our teachings and those we serve.

 

I hope that his sense of love continues to be what guides us and what defines us as human beings and as a university, Carlos Albizu University.
